Go-Around at DCA: Aircraft Declares Emergency After Vehicle on Runway

- ✈️ An aircraft declared a go-around maneuver due to a vehicle on the runway at DCA.
- ⚠️ The pilot reported the vehicle as a potential hazard, prompting the immediate decision to abort the landing.
Air Traffic Control Communication
- 💬 Air traffic control (ATC) provided clearance for landing on runway 33.
- 📞 The pilot of "4528" confirmed they were able to land and were cleared to do so.
- 🚨 Another aircraft, "6101," also executed a go-around, turning left heading 280, maintaining 3000 feet.
Runway Safety Concerns
- 🚧 The presence of a vehicle on the active runway created a critical safety situation.
- 🔍 Pilots and ATC were actively monitoring the situation, with one pilot reporting the departing 73 in sight.
- 💨 The go-around was initiated to ensure separation and prevent a potential collision.
Airport Operations at DCA
- 📍 The incident occurred at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port (DCA).
- 🛫 Multiple aircraft were involved in takeoff and landing operations, including departures from runway 1 and landings on runway 33.
- 📻 Communications were managed by ground and tower controllers, coordinating traffic flow.
